MEMO — Branch Managers

Hi all — quick heads-up: starting next quarter, Fernvale Systems is moving most customers to annual billing. Monthly plans stay for legacy accounts only. Why? Fewer invoices, steadier cash flow, and less churn-chasing in January. Please brief your front-desk teams and flag any clients likely to push back so Mira's team can prep retention offers. Training decks land Friday. Before you discuss externally, read the note below.

board note of kageg-bahof: The renewal with Holwynax Holdings closes at $2 million a year, 5 percent below the last contract. Project Ulaath slips by two quarters because of the supplier delay.

**Ticket: Config drift on BounceSift processor**

The email bounce processor in the Larkfield environment has drifted from the values committed in the release branch. Retry windows and suppression thresholds no longer match, which likely explains the duplicate suppression entries reported Tuesday. Please reconcile before the Thursday cut. For reference, the currently deployed configuration on the live node reads as follows.

config for yajep-yahof:
[briax]
port = 9200
region = outer-2
host = briax.nelvrocorp.test
team = raleth
timeout_ms = 1500
retries = 1

## Fix memory leak in GlyphCache image store

This PR fixes a leak in the Pennywhistle app's GlyphCache module. Decoded bitmaps were retained by an eviction listener that held strong references, so the cache grew unbounded under heavy scrolling. For anyone new to the codebase: GlyphCache sits between the downloader and the renderer, and its sizing knobs live in one module. This change switches to weak references, adds an explicit trim pass, and adjusts the sizing constants. The updated values are listed below:

tuning table, yajog-yahof:
BUDGETS = {
    "lamvan": 303,
    "wenox": 460,
    "fenvan": 525,
}